A Poem by JoJo Hallows

Momma was so happy I found someone who illuminated me like a star. A fire to match my burning flame, let it commence.

Burning it all like a wild fire; we left our trail in the blaze.

Why do we torture ourselves with our passions? You burned out just to leave me to fade away.
